Shopian: Militants used women as human shield, says Army

Shopian: Army on Thursday said militants killed in Shopian encounter used women as human shield while trying to escape from the cordon.
At least two militants were killed in an encounter with government forces in Dairoo’s Chaigund area in Shopian district on Wednesday. A local teenager, Shakir Ahmad, was also killed and two women sustained grave injuries amid clashes in the area.
Addressing a press conference at Balpura, Shopian, Commander 12RR Brigadier Harbir Singh said army received continuous inputs for the last few days that some militants were planning to carry out attacks ahead of the January 26.
“We were closely tracking the militant group for five to six days and on Wednesday around 5 pm we received specific input about the presence of militants in a house at Ooda,” Singh said. “We immediately cordoned the area and asked civilians to vacate the house.”
The Brigadier said some eight to ten women came out from the house wearing burka. “While these women reached nearby, we suspected two militants, clad in burka, among them,” he said. “They (militants) tried to escape under the garb of cloak. They were using women as human shields.”
As army challenged the militants, they opened fire, Singh said. “Our party retaliated fire in air to disperse the women and in the meantime, both militants ran away towards a cowshed ensuing intense gunfight which continued for an hour.”
“The encounter ended with killing of both militants, the Commander said. “One of the militants has been identified as Firdous Lone resident of Ganawpora who became active in September 2016 and another was a local who joined militancy in September last year.”
Terming the killing of militants as big victory, Harbir said there was a possibility that gunmen were about to carry a Fidayeen attack.
He said this is the first time that militants were seen trying to escape while wearing burka. “We tried our best to ensure that no civilian is injured but unfortunately in such circumstances, we failed to do so,” the Brigadier said.
